last year i bought the kids age 8&10 both dare2be jackets from ebay (they were new with tags) I only paid about £15 each which is enough to pay (as I put them straight on ebay when we returned and made the money back!) they were excellent jackets but it wasnt worth keeping hold of them for this season as they would have outgrown them. They were warm enough and waterproof enough and I thought they looked lovely on the slopes with them. I wouldnt hesitate to buy. A good tip is to take them to TKmax and try them on so you know what size to get, then if you see them cheaper online you can buy with confidence that they will fit.
